将可视类作为 Java bean 或应用程序来运行

在开发可视类时,可以运行它以测试它的外观和行为。

当使用 Visual Editor 来运行 Java bean 或应用程序时,将创建一个虚拟机,该虚拟机使用该项目的 Java 构建路径中指定的类路径。然后,使用 Java bean 的空构造函数来将其实例化。

  • 如果该 Java bean 是一个可视类(即,它是 java.awt.Component 的子类),则会创建适当的窗口以包含该可视 Java bean。
  • 如果该 bean 是 AWT Java bean 的部件或继承自 AWT Java bean,则该窗口是 java.awt.Dialog
  • 如果该 bean 是 Swing 类或继承自 Swing 类,则该窗口是 javax.swing.JDialog
  • 如果该 bean 是 SWT 类,则该窗口是 SWT Shell。如果可视 Java bean 由于其本身就是一个窗口而不需要窗口,则该 Java bean 在实例化之后将变为可视的并且被指定缺省大小。

当将类作为 Java bean 或应用程序运行时,将自动创建启动配置。启动配置用来启动一个虚拟机,该虚拟机将该类实例化并允许测试该类。如果已存在正在运行的类的启动配置,则将使用该启动配置。

要将可视类作为 Java bean 或应用程序来运行:

  1. 在 Visual Editor 中打开可视 Java 类。
  2. 从主菜单中,选择下列其中一个选项:
    • 运行 > 运行方式 > Java 应用程序(如果类具有 public static void main(String[]) 方法的话)。
    • 运行 > 运行方式 > Java bean(如果类不具有 main 方法的话)。
将启动用来将类实例化的虚拟机,并且 Java bean 或应用程序在工作台顶部运行。于是,您可以测试 Java 类的行为和性能。
相关概念
Java bean 异常
用于调试 Java bean 的高级选项
相关任务
为运行 Java bean 或应用程序而配置选项
调试可视 Java bean 或应用程序
测试和部署 applet

(C) Copyright IBM Corporation 1999, 2006. All Rights Reserved.